How Common Is The Last Name Mykhalchuk? popularity and diffusion

This last name is the 45,050th most commonly held surname worldwide, borne by around 1 in 632,435 people. This last name is mostly found in Europe, where 100 percent of Mykhalchuk reside; 100 percent reside in Eastern Europe and 100 percent reside in East Slavic Europe.

The surname is most commonly used in Ukraine, where it is held by 11,477 people, or 1 in 3,966. In Ukraine it is most frequent in: Volyn Oblast, where 18 percent are found, Rivne Oblast, where 12 percent are found and Khmelnytskyi Oblast, where 9 percent are found. Excluding Ukraine Mykhalchuk occurs in 13 countries. It also occurs in Greece, where 0 percent are found and The United States, where 0 percent are found.
